摘要
A dichloromethane extract from Dictamnus dasycarpus showed a suppressive effect on umu gene expression of the SOS response in Salmonella typhimurium TA1535/pSK1002 against the mutagen 2-(2-furyl)-3-(5-nitro-2-furyl)acrylamide (furylfuramide). The suppressive compound in the dichloromethane extract from D. dasycarpus was isolated by SiO2 column chromatography and identified as isofraxinellone by EI-MS and H-1 and C-13 NMR spectroscopy. Isofraxinellone exhibited an inhibition of the SOS-inducing activity of furylfuramide in the umu test. Gene expression was suppressed completely at less than 0.86 mu mol/mL, and the ID50 value was 0.35 mu mol/mL. Fraxinellone, which was one of the major components in D. dasycarpus, was also isolated, but this compound did not show any suppressive effect on the SOS induction of furylfuramide. Isofraxinellone was also assayed with the mutagen 3-amino-1,4-dimethyl-5H-pyrido[4,3-b]indole (Trp-P-l), which requires liver metabolizing enzymes, and showed a suppressive effect similar to that with furylfuramide. Its ID50 value against Trp-P-l was 0.50 mu mol/mL. The antimutagenic activities of isofraxinellone against furylfuramide and Trp-P-l were tested by an Ames test using Salmonella typhimurium TA100, which indicated that isofraxinellone showed antimutagenic activity.
